Output d4090e7d0cedbb9491e5d495c5a314b30b1ba6c591ac2350d5ddce6a3dc195c6:0

value
1700608
script pubkey
OP_HASH160 OP_PUSHBYTES_20 84b64a46ee4353e958edbc748208efa528c1ebed OP_EQUAL
address
3DnjVc97WY7qzg65DZqPh7sftsGWfgX1oP
transaction
d4090e7d0cedbb9491e5d495c5a314b30b1ba6c591ac2350d5ddce6a3dc195c6
spent
true